Transaction

b0a07368f08d258269e69213cd8d0c5fb7e5edd9ac4fa74f136cb5f074e75d07
429,541 confirmations
Timestamp
1520008246
Block511,658
Fee9,849 sats
Fee rate1.13 sats/vB
view on mempool.space

Inputs & Outputs